The total volume of the Pacific Ocean is estimated to be 7.20 x 10^8 km^3. A medium-sized atomic bomb produces 1.00 x 10^15 J of energy upon explosion. Calculate the number of atomic bombs needed to release enough energy to raise the temperature of the water in the Pacific Ocean by 1.000 degrees C. Enter your answer in scientific notation.
